Causes of Hikvision Monitoring Display Refresh Rate Exceedances: Several factors can contribute to a Hikvision monitoring display exceeding its designated refresh rate. These can range from simple configuration errors to more complex hardware or software issues. Let's examine some of the most prevalent causes:
1. Incorrect System Configuration: One of the most common reasons for refresh rate issues is incorrect configuration within the Hikvision system itself. This could involve mistakenly setting the refresh rate too high for the monitor's capabilities, leading to display errors or instability. Improperly configured network settings can also contribute, causing data overload and forcing the display to struggle to keep up. This often manifests as flickering, tearing, or complete display failure.
2. Network Bandwidth Limitations: High-resolution video streams from multiple Hikvision cameras require substantial network bandwidth. If the network infrastructure is insufficient to handle the data throughput, it can cause delays and ultimately lead to the display attempting to compensate by increasing its refresh rate beyond its limits. This is especially problematic in large-scale deployments with numerous cameras transmitting high-bitrate video streams.
3. Hardware Limitations: The capabilities of the video management system (VMS), network switch, and the display itself play a crucial role. An outdated or underpowered VMS might struggle to process the incoming video data efficiently, resulting in refresh rate issues. Similarly, a low-bandwidth network switch can create bottlenecks. The monitor itself might have limitations on its maximum supported refresh rate, leading to errors when the system attempts to exceed these limits.
4. Software Conflicts or Bugs: Software conflicts or bugs within the Hikvision software, drivers, or operating system can disrupt the normal operation of the display and trigger refresh rate problems. Outdated or corrupted drivers are particularly notorious for causing instability and unexpected behavior. This requires careful attention to software updates and patching to ensure compatibility and stability.
5. Overheating: While less common, overheating components within the VMS, network devices, or even the monitor itself can affect performance and potentially lead to refresh rate issues as the system attempts to compensate for the degraded performance caused by high temperatures. Proper ventilation and ambient temperature monitoring are important to prevent this.

Troubleshooting and Solutions: Addressing Hikvision display refresh rate exceedances requires a systematic approach, starting with the most straightforward solutions and progressing to more complex ones:
1. Verify Monitor Specifications: Begin by checking the monitor's specifications to ensure that the system's refresh rate settings are within the monitor's supported range. Lowering the refresh rate to a supported value is the simplest solution.
2. Adjust Hikvision System Settings: Review and adjust the Hikvision system settings, including video resolution, frame rate, and bitrate. Reducing these parameters can significantly lessen the load on the network and the display.
3. Optimize Network Bandwidth: Assess the network infrastructure and ensure it can handle the data throughput required by the number of cameras and their video settings. Consider upgrading network components or optimizing network traffic to improve bandwidth.
4. Update Drivers and Software: Ensure all drivers and software are up-to-date. Outdated or corrupted drivers can lead to instability. Regular software updates are crucial for maintaining optimal system performance and stability.
5. Check Hardware: Inspect the hardware for any signs of malfunction, overheating, or damage. Consider replacing faulty components to restore proper system functionality.
